> Harvey --
> 
>> they have subwebs, after many hours, I find this is not supported on the
>> Cobalt Raq3. So, the resolution to create additional users, with FP
> 
> If FrontPage 2000 server extensions are installed, there should be no
> problem with your user creating subwebs, and the RaQ3 does come with those
> extensions.  You should be able to find a patch/upgrade somewhere for them
> if they aren't on your machine.

You must create subwebs with the GUI with front page on a Raq3 they are not
automatic like on a NT server. You have to create a user name of the subweb
(www.domainname.com/widget) widget is the user name you would have to make
in the GUI

With any front page NT/Raq website you have to Create a new search database.
you can not transfer over from one server to another.

I moved over 15 websites over from a W2000 server to a Raq3 and I had to
republish most of the sites from scratch that used Front page Options like
search pages and any other MS gizmos.
